  • Patent number: 6999433
    Abstract: HPNA MxU network for an MxU, the MxU including a plurality of HPNA LANs, each of the HPNA LANs operating according to a synchronous communication specification. Each of the HPNA LANs includes a plurality of nodes, one of the nodes within each HPNA LAN being a gateway node, a selected one of the nodes within each HPNA LAN being defined a LAN-master node and each HPNA LAN is coupled with a WAN via the respective gateway node. The LAN-master nodes allow the gateway nodes to transmit within a selected HPNA LAN downstream signals during at least one time slot, and the LAN-master nodes allow the nodes other than the gateway nodes to transmit upstream signals within a selected HPNA LAN to the respective gateway or transmit HN signals within a selected HPNA LAN, between nodes other than the respective gateway nodes during at least another timeslot.

  • Patent number: 6950411
    Abstract: A mobile user receiver having a cancellation system for removing selected signals from a traffic signal prior to decoding includes a receiver having a system input for receiving communication signals from a transmitter over an air interface. The system input is supplied to a traffic signal cancellation system for canceling unwanted traffic signals. The system input is also supplied to a pilot signal cancellation system for removing a global pilot signal. The output of the pilot signal cancellation system is subtracted from the output of the traffic signal cancellation system to provide a cancellation system output free from unwanted traffic signals and the global pilot signal.
